Instance: Deadmines
Characters: 5 x Draenei Shaman
Level: 21/22 (dinged shortly after starting)
Spec: All are elemental X/0/0
Gear: Quest and mob drops only

Comments: I'm still learning my way and Deadmines was a nice way to ease into instance running. There are mostly scattered non-elites with no large groups of elites- at level 21/22 there are almost no problems with aggro range so pulls were kept to 1-3 mobs most of the time. I did have two occasions where I pulled 4-5 elites along with 1-2 non-elites but managed to burn them all down without any deaths.

I wanted to wait for level 20 to get the healing stream totem, which is why I ended up entering at level 21 and dinging 22 shortly after. The healing stream totem was an enormous edge, +30 healing every 2 seconds meant that I spent very little time healing.

I one-shot every boss with the exception of Van Cleef. I wiped on him the first attempt, then killed him on the second attempt before dying to his last two adds. But I was able to zone in and clear to the corpse before it poofed, so I was happy enough with that. I still need to work on my macros and my responsiveness during fights, but overall I was pretty happy with the attempt.
